MyState Financial First Tasmanian Sponsor of Tasmanian AFL Team

26 August 2008

MyState Financial today announced it will become the first major Tasmanian sponsor of the future Tasmanian AFL team.

MyState Financial chief executive Chris Brooks said MyState Financial will commit $300,000 for three years - $100,000 a year - when Tasmania wins a licence from the AFL.

"MyState Financial are strong supporters of the Tasmanian AFL Bid and I am pleased to announce we are the first major Tasmanian sponsor for the future team," Mr Brooks said.

"We know that Tasmania can and will present an economically sustainable bid to the AFL.

"As the largest Tasmanian-owned financial institution, we believe there will be substantial long-term financial and social benefits to the State of a Tasmanian AFL team.

"As a State we have already seen the financial benefits of playing four AFL premiership games at Aurora Stadium – with our own AFL Team those benefits will increase exponentially.

"With 11 home games a year, as well as the flow-on effects with people employed directly and indirectly with a Tasmanian AFL team, we can see real benefit to Tasmania.

"Further, the long-term benefits of an AFL team for grass roots football and encouraging outdoor activity in our young people will be substantial."

Mr Brooks said MyState Financial will begin its support of the Tasmanian AFL Bid immediately.

"We will distribute information about the Tasmanian AFL Bid to the 12,000 MyState Financial Footy Tippers this week, encouraging them to register at www.tassiefootyteam.com.au.

"We will also distribute information about our sponsorship of the future Tasmanian AFL team to the 140,000 members of MyState Financial across the State.

"A link to the Tasmanian AFL Bid website will go live on our homepage today, so that our members can seek regular updates on the progress of the Tasmanian AFL Bid."

"And, starting this week, a framed Guernsey and supporters' board will be sent on a roadshow around all our branches for staff and members to show their support."

Mr Brooks said MyState Financial had monitored the progress of the Tasmanian AFL Bid closely.

"We have seen the growing support in Tasmania and interstate.

"To think that almost 25 per cent of Tasmanians would consider joining a future Tasmanian AFL club as members without a team even in existence is impressive.

"And now we hear there’s also strong support from interstate, with more than 80 per cent of 14,000 people surveyed Australia-wide showing support for a Tasmanian team in the AFL.

"Of course MARS’ commitment of $4 million for the first three years and the launch of the Believe bars last week has been fantastic and we are pleased to join with them as supporters.

"All of this activity indicates there is a growing shift of increased support for Our Team, and we know that Tasmania will be ready to seize whatever opportunities arise in their bid.

"We believe there will be many more Tasmanian companies interested in supporting both bid and the Tasmanian AFL team, and we encourage them to join us."

The Tasmanian AFL Guernsey will be scheduled to visit all MyState Financial locations over the next three months. The schedule will be published on mystate.com.au.
